The feast of sacrifice
For Muslims around the world, Eid al-Adha, or the Feast of Sacrifice, is one of the most important holidays of the year. It coincides with the final rites of the annual pilgrimage to Mecca and commemorates the sacrifice of the prophet Ibrahim.
Highlighted in the Islamic calendar among the most prominent celebratory occasions, Eid al-Adha is traditionally marked with devout Muslims buying and slaughtering animals and sharing two-thirds of the meat with the poor.
This year, the festivities, including a special prayer followed by the sacrifice of an animal, took place between 5 and 9 June.

Indonesia
Together with IDEP, Octa supported 37 single mothers across Bali as a part of the Family Bucket Project. Single mothers in Bali face significant economic and social challenges rooted in unstable incomes, inadequate labour protection, and vulnerable living conditions. They often struggle to meet even their basic needs and those of their children, while insufficient education and professional skills further hinder their access to employment in Bali's tourism-dominated economy.
These challenges become even more pronounced during Eid al-Adha, when single mothers must work even harder to provide the best they can for their children. Octa and IDEP distributed targeted support packages to 37 single-mother households in Bali to help them enjoy the holiday.
